Transaction 1743543b07018553203ab77038bc17f718c4c8b4e108371c6f64386c3fb62321

1 Input
2 Outputs
  • 1743543b07018553203ab77038bc17f718c4c8b4e108371c6f64386c3fb62321:0
  • value  6550000
    address  3BDNJaL3qQQbj1Wu74h6Wi8yCed3gqpknE
  • 1743543b07018553203ab77038bc17f718c4c8b4e108371c6f64386c3fb62321:1
  • value  7933
    address  3FgP7HLL3zEN8S5dbmamr5K2rtYV1KHMJ2